what is Japan Rail Pass or JR pass?

It is a rail pass that allows foreign tourists to make unlimited journeys in Japan by using the JR-operated rail system. Not only trains but also JR-operated buses and ferries can be boarded for free using this pass.

Hiroshima-Miyajima ferry
But in this case, keep in mind that Nozomi and Mizuho shinkansen service, private train service, and the metro service are excluded from this pass.

JR Bus
Another important question is Who Can Use the Japan Rail Pass?

This pass cannot be used by any Japanese resident but in some cases, foreigners are also unable to use it. This Pass is only available for non-Japanese nationals on short tourism visits and Japanese nationals who live outside Japan and meet certain conditions. This means foreigners with a single-entry temporary tourist visa for 15-90 days can use this japan rail pass. 

Those who are not eligible who has these kinds of visa types:

  • Long term visas which allow staying in Japan for more than 90 days
  • Student visa
  • Permanent residency visa
  • Tokubetsu Eijuken holders (Special permanent residency visa)
  • Entertainer visa
  • Working holiday visa
  • Military entry status
  • Any other visas which are not temporary visitor visas with the purpose of sightseeing.

Suppose you have planned a 7 days trip and your journey is a bit like this-

If your journey starts from Tokyo then Kyoto, Osaka, Hiroshima, and Nagasaki, and back to Tokyo again then the total cost is around 624 dollars, but if you travel with this pass, it becomes 279 dollars. That means you can save almost 345 dollars!

Well, if you have a fourteen-day plan instead of seven days, it should cost 625 dollars, but using this pass your costs will be 445 dollars and you can save 180. I hope things are pretty clear right!

What Pass Options are There?

This pass has 3 types of duration available. 7 days, 14 days, and 21 days, so that you can choose the right length pass for your trip. There are also different passes for adults and children, providing a great discount for children. There is also a JR Green Pass for those who want to travel by first class which will provide a much more comfortable ride to the passengers. Now let’s come to another important topic. So how to use Japan Rail Pass?

The tourist can't use this pass as an ordinary train ticket. It has few steps to activate and use. Don't worry let me describe it for you, hope that will clear the matter easily.

Purchase Your Pass: At first, you need to purchase the pass. please remember not to buy tickets too soon, cause passes can only be purchased up to 6 months in advance of the date you plan to use them.

Exchange Order: Once you’ve purchased your pass, JRPass.com will send a slip of paper called an “Exchange Order” to you via mail wherever you are in the world. You must keep this Exchange Order somewhere safe.

By the way, you can collect your pass from anywhere in the world. For example: if you collect from the USA, it will take one day and the cost will be 14 dollars, In the same way, you can check exactly how long it will take to collect from your country and how much it will cost.

Travel to Japan: The day is finally here and it’s time to travel to Japan for your trip. Don't forget to pack your Exchange Order and bring it with you.

After your arrival in Japan, the first thing you should do is to go to a JR Service Center or exchange office with your exchange order and passport with you. Don’t worry there are exchange offices in all major airports as well as most big cities.

Get Your Japan Rail Pass: Once at the office, you’ll hand both your order and passport over and fill out a form identifying your “Activation Day”, i.e., the date you would like to start using your Japan Rail Pass.

Travel with your JR Pass: Finally, on the activation day you choose, look for the JR symbol at the station. Once at the turnstiles, show the attendant your pass and they’ll allow you to enter.
